Conor McGregor appeal against civil jury’s rape finding due before Court of Appeal this month

Mixed Martial Arts fighter expected to claim jury finding is unsafe because of alleged legal and factual errors



Conor McGregor is appealing a civil jury's finding that he raped a woman in a Dublin hotel. The appeal, scheduled for March 21st, claims the trial judge made legal and factual errors, including in directions to the jury regarding evidence and the definition of assault. McGregor seeks to overturn the finding and potentially have a retrial ordered. The civil jury previously awarded €248,603 damages to the woman, who alleged non-consensual sexual activity, while McGregor claimed the sex was consensual.
